我(以及大约一百万人)在IE11中发现了一个错误(不确定其他版本是否有相同的错误),如果你创建一个HTML5音频标签,浏览器会报告"无效来源",无论如何.我已经尝试过每一个我能想到的组合而没有运气.到目前为止:将HTML结束标记从自闭合更改为显式更改文件名以消除任何奇怪的字符将音频子格式更改为每个可能的设置添加显式URI("http:// ...")禁用所有插件(有库存插件)尝试每种可能的音频格式定义MIME类型更改音频标签的参数.更改了IIS设置以包含MIME类型.

检查微软的"连接"网站 - (他们声称它不可复制,但数十万的谷歌搜索结果表明不然).

这根本不可能吗?我尝试过的所有其他最新和最好的浏览器(FireFox,Opera,Safari,Chrome)我现在已经结束了 - 没有解决方案可行.

这是代码:

代码背后:

Partial Class AudioPopupPlayer

Inherits System.Web.UI.Page

Protected Sub Page_Load(sender As Object, e As EventArgs) Handles Me.Load

Dim VoiceOverFileName As String = Request.QueryString("vo")

If VoiceOverFileName.Length > 0 Then

Dim root As String = HttpContext.Current.Request.Url.GetLeftPart(UriPartial.Authority) + ResolveUrl("~/")

Dim audiosource As String = ""

Me.litVoiceOver.Text = audiosource

End If

End Sub

End Class

最后,屏幕截图(在IE11中)显示HTML呈现完美,但我仍然得到可怕的"无效源"消息(注意:复制和粘贴链接会导致音频文件播放 - 去图).

html 无效源,IE bug无效源HTML5音频 - 解决方法相关推荐

  1. Android 源码编译及常见错误及解决方法

    Android 源码编译及常见错误及解决方法 参考文章: (1)Android 源码编译及常见错误及解决方法 (2)https://www.cnblogs.com/kyyblabla/p/360393 ...

  2. 云帆教育大数据分享-Flume-0.9.4源码编译及一些编译出错解决方法

    Flume-0.9.4源码编译及一些编译出错解决方法 由于需要在Flume里面加入一些我需要的代码,这时候就需要重新编译Flume代码,因为在编译Flume源码的时候出现了很多问题,所以写出这篇博客, ...

  3. ecshop退出登录会清空购物车的bug优化,最完美解决方法

    ecshop退出登录会清空购物车的bug优化,最完美解决方法 参考文章: (1)ecshop退出登录会清空购物车的bug优化,最完美解决方法 (2)https://www.cnblogs.com/wa ...

  4. lol进入服务器后显示3秒白屏,LOL:盘点新客户端出现的BUG,及可行的解决方法...

    原标题:LOL:盘点新客户端出现的BUG,及可行的解决方法 自从LOL客户端强制改版后,引发无数人的吐槽.虽然相对新客户端来说,玩家熟悉度更高,BUG基本上也没有.但是老客户端不也是慢慢的更新换代而来 ...

  5. 跟踪调试JDK源码时遇到的问题及解决方法

    目录 问题描述 解决思路 在IntelliJ IDEA中调试JDK源码 在eclipse中调试JDK源码 总结 问题描述 最近在研究MyBatis的缓存机制,需要回顾一下HashMap的实现原理.于是 ...

  6. AD域控Exchange邮箱(二)——卸载ExchangeServer2010报错:“有些控件无效 - 请指定要卸载的现有服务器” 解决方法

    目录 问题描述 原因分析 解决方法 已开始,正常卸载 问题描述 exchange邮箱出问题,需要进行卸载重装.但是在卸载exchange过程中,报错:"有些控件无效 - 请指定要卸载的现有服 ...

  7. 亚马逊ASIN无效怎么办?Amazon asin无法创建的解决方法

    亚马逊ASIN,全称"Amazon Standard Identification Number",也就是亚马逊标准识别编码.商品上架后,亚马逊会自动赋予商品一个由10个字母组成的 ...

  8. U3d引擎崩溃、异常、警告、BUG与提示总结及解决方法

    此贴会持续更新,都是项目中常会遇到的问题,总结成贴,提醒自己和方便日后检查,也能帮到有需要的同学. 若各位有啥好BUG好异常好警告好崩溃可以分享的话,请多多指教.xuzhiping7#qq.com. ...

  9. Centos6配置在线yarm源 Centos6 网易源阿里源都失效用不了的解决方法

    忽然发现,以前配置的,网上很多文章写的, 网易源,阿里源. 在2020年都用不了,打开也是404了. 好在centos官方提供了一个源,速度也不错. vim /etc/yum.repos.d/Cent ...

最新文章

  1. esp32-cam的原理图
  2. centos下修改mysql默认端口_CentOS下修改Apache默认端口80
  3. 你的 GitHub 代码已打包运往北极,传给 1000 年后人类
  4. 用c语言实现蚂蚁算法,rsa算法的c语言实现
  5. 英特尔携手百度全方位深化合作 共筑智能生态
  6. 用maven建立一个工程2
  7. java程序中单方法接口通常是,Android面试题1--Java基础之线程(持续更新)
  8. mysql从库新增_MySQL新增从库
  9. php Hash Table(二) Hash函数
  10. 完整版彻底卸载SQL Server2019
  11. 旧电脑再次起飞 分享一次联想Thinkpad X230黑苹果的完整过程
  12. 我的印度IT之都清奈之行
  13. 【ultraiso制作ubuntu启动盘(包括U盘和光盘)】
  14. [C++]typedef typename什么意思?
  15. 使用kettle来根据时间戳或者批次号来批量导入数据,达到增量的效果。
  16. 各种OOM代码样例及解决方法
  17. Linux内核设计与实现(13)第十三章:虚拟文件系统
  18. Windows输入法 字母间隙突然变大
  19. 中国科学院计算机网络信息中心科学数据中心,中科院计算机网络信息中心简介...
  20. HTML静态页面总体设计思路,网页设计与制作(HTML+CSS+JavaScript)(张洪斌 刘万辉)课程整体设计...

热门文章

  1. criscriter英语测试软件,iTEST大学英语测试与训练系统
  2. python 百度百科 爬虫_爬虫爬取百度百科数据
  3. pythonappend用法_python中append实例用法总结
  4. 笔记本电脑没有鼠标怎么右键_联想笔记本电脑没有声音怎么修复
  5. mysql存储引擎的方式_Mysql转换表存储引擎的三种方式
  6. golang string 加号连接性能慢_面试必备:浅析C#性能优化的若干种方法
  7. powerbuilder查询符合条件的数据并且过滤掉其他数据_论文浅尝 ISWC2020 | KnowlyBERT: 知识图谱结合语言模型补全图谱查询...
  8. [C][变量作用域]语句块
  9. Fragment滑动切换简单案例
  10. day17(JDBC入门jdbcUtils工具介绍)